lizhiguo 发表于 2008-3-16 10:05:08

同步时钟

各位老师,盟友,大家好!
   我想利用mega128的spi接口做个同步时钟,用主机来控制从机的6段数码管,从而达到两机的时钟同步,在编程时我已经编好了主机的时钟程序,它是动态显示的,我想问问,利用spi接口,它能不能传到从机上,从而达到两机同步的目的?他们是怎样传送和接收的呢?谢谢大家了!!

machao 发表于 2008-3-16 10:49:59

1.能
2.主从机只有一个钟,但从机的显示比主机晚(ms级),因为传送和处理需要时间.
3.先学习SPI的协议和基本应用.
4.不用谢.

lizhiguo 发表于 2008-3-19 14:32:27

马老师,各位老师,大家好!
  马老师,我看了您的"串行接口SPI接口应用设计"一篇,也试着运行了一下那个程序,但看到没什么效果?
 我用的是双龙公司的AVR系统,我把芯片的mosi(12脚,pb2)---miso(13脚,pb3)连起来,用iccavr调试程序,然后用studio4.0下载程序,而且已经下载成功了,但好象没什么效果?
 我预想程序运行的效果:有一个地方叫我们输入字符,因为有spigetchar()函数,紧接着会输出显示那个字符.
 我还想问一下,双龙公司的AVR系统的数码管有4个8,我不知道数码管与io口的对应情况,我们老师告诉我编程时只要设置io口就可以了,系统会自动的把它对应到数码管上去,我想问问,通过软件设置可以配置io口与数码管的连接情况吗?
 你的那本<<AVR单片机嵌入式系统原理与应用>>上的那些数码管显示程序的连线情况可都是先把线连好了的啊?那我们在系统板上就不可能像那样连啊.谢谢马老师和各位老师了!!
页: [1]
查看完整版本: 同步时钟